What is an Energy Drink?

At its core, an energy drink is a non-alcoholic functional beverage specifically formulated to provide mental and physical stimulation. Unlike sports drinks (such as Gatorade or Powerade), which are designed to replenish fluids and electrolytes lost during intense sweat sessions, energy drinks are strictly performance enhancers designed to temporarily ward off fatigue.

The modern energy drink landscape is divided into two major eras:

  • The Legacy Era: Pioneered by brands like Red Bull, Monster, and Rockstar in the late 1990s and early 2000s, these drinks traditionally leaned into a formula of high sugar, high caffeine, and aggressive, counter-culture marketing.
  • The Fitness and Performance Era: Driven by newer companies like Celsius, Ghost, and Alani Nu, this generation markets itself as "clean" fitness fuels or cognitive enhancers. They are usually completely sugar-free and packed with vitamins, fat burners, or focus-enhancing chemical compounds.

Regardless of whether a can features edgy graphics or clean, minimalist wellness branding, they all share a singular goal: introducing a massive spike of stimulants directly into your central nervous system.

Deconstructing the Liquid: What Ingredients Are in Energy Drinks?

Flip any energy drink around to read the ingredient panel, and you will find an intimidating block of text. While every company guards their "proprietary blends" fiercely, almost all energy drinks rely on the same core group of building blocks to force your body into an alert state.

1. Caffeine (The Core Driver)

Caffeine is the undisputed engine of the energy drink. It functions as a central nervous system stimulant by chemically binding to your brain’s adenosine receptors. Adenosine is the natural compound that builds up in your brain throughout the day, signaling to your body that it is tired. By blocking these receptors, caffeine tricks your brain into thinking it is completely rested. Energy drinks utilize both synthetic caffeine (cheap and fast-acting) and natural caffeine derived from green tea or coffee beans.

2. Massive Doses of Sugar (or Artificial Sweeteners)

In traditional energy drinks, sugar acts as a secondary fuel source. It provides a fast caloric burst that works in tandem with caffeine. However, because modern consumers are increasingly wary of metabolic issues, many brands have swapped sucrose and high-fructose corn syrup for intense artificial sweeteners like sucraloseand acesulfame potassium (Ace-K).

3. Taurine

Taurine is an amino acid that naturally occurs in the human body, particularly in the brain, heart, and skeletal muscles. It plays a key role in neurological development and regulating water and mineral levels in the blood. In energy drinks, it is included because some early research suggests it supports athletic endurance and, paradoxically, acts as a mild nervous system calmer to take the jittery edge off the massive doses of caffeine.

4. Guarana Extract

Guarana is a plant native to the Amazon basin, and its seeds contain about four times the concentration of caffeine found in coffee beans. This is a critical ingredient to watch: when a company lists guarana extract on the label, they are adding an extra layer of unquantified caffeine into the beverage that might not be fully accounted for in the primary caffeine total.

5. B-Vitamin Complexes

Energy drinks are regularly fortified with jaw-dropping percentages of B-vitamins—specifically Vitamin B6 (pyridoxine) and Vitamin B12 (cobalamin). It is incredibly common to see a label boasting 100% to 500% of your daily recommended intake. While B-vitamins are vital for converting food into cellular energy, consuming them via a beverage doesn't grant bonus energy; if your body already has enough B-vitamins, it simply filters the excess out through your urine.

6. Amino Acids and Nootropics

The newest wave of drinks includes compounds like L-Carnitine (which helps transport fatty acids into cells to be burned for energy), BCAAs (branched-chain amino acids for muscle recovery), and nootropics like Alpha-GPC or L-Theanine, which are designed to enhance memory, focus, and executive cognitive functioning.

What Are the Health Risks of Energy Drinks

Because energy drinks bypass the natural, slower digestion process of a warm beverage like coffee or tea, they hit your bloodstream with intense speed. Consuming them regularly or in large volumes introduces a clear set of physiological risks.

Cardiovascular Strain

The most immediate and critical risk associated with energy drinks lands directly on the heart. The heavy combination of caffeine and secondary stimulants like guarana forces the heart muscle to contract harder and faster. This elevates blood pressure and can trigger arrhythmias (irregular heartbeats), palpitations, and in severe cases, sudden cardiac events. This is especially true for young adults who may have underlying, undiagnosed structural heart conditions.

The Insulin Crash and Metabolic Harm

For versions that are not sugar-free, the sheer volume of sugar is hazardous. A single 16-ounce classic energy drink can dump up to 60 grams of pure sugar into your digestive tract. This forces the pancreas to pump out massive amounts of insulin to clear the glucose from your blood. The result is a sharp, aggressive energy crash within 90 minutes, accompanied by long-term risks of developing insulin resistance, type 2 diabetes, and visceral fat accumulation.

Central Nervous System Overdrive

Because energy drinks are consumed cold and fast, the rapid onset of 200 mg or more of caffeine can completely overwhelm your central nervous system. This manifests as acute anxiety, muscle tremors, irritability, and panic attacks. Furthermore, consuming these beverages past midday severely disrupts your circadian rhythm, reducing deep REM sleep and locking you into a vicious cycle where you need another energy drink the next morning just to function.

Kidney and Liver Taxing

Filtering out high concentrations of synthetic vitamins, artificial dyes (like Red 40 or Yellow 5), and chemical preservatives puts a chronic processing burden on your liver and kidneys. Furthermore, caffeine is a natural diuretic; if you are using energy drinks to power through a hot workout or a grueling shift without drinking adequate water, you are setting the stage for chronic dehydration and potential kidney stones.

Popular Energy Drinks Ranked by Caffeine Content

To help put the market into clear perspective, here are 10 of the most widely consumed energy drinks available today. They are organized strictly from lowest caffeine content to highest caffeine content, utilizing their standard flagship can sizes.

BrandStandard Serving SizeCaffeine ContentPrimary Sweetener Type
1. Red Bull8.4 fl oz (Small Can)80 mgSucrose & Glucose
2. Red Bull (Large)12 fl oz (Medium Can)114 mgSucrose & Glucose
3. Monster Energy (Original)16 fl oz (Tall Boy)160 mgSucrose & Glucose
4. Rockstar Energy (Original)16 fl oz (Tall Boy)160 mgSugar & High Fructose Corn Syrup
5. NOS Energy16 fl oz (Tall Boy)160 mgHigh Fructose Corn Syrup
6. Celsius12 fl oz (Slim Can)200 mgSucrose-Free (Sucralose)
7. Alani Nu12 fl oz (Slim Can)200 mgSucrose-Free (Sucralose)
8. Ghost Energy16 fl oz (Tall Boy)200 mgSucrose-Free (Sucralose)
9. C4 Energy16 fl oz (Tall Boy)200 mgSucrose-Free (Sucralose)
10. Reign Total Body Fuel16 fl oz (Tall Boy)300 mgSucrose-Free (Sucralose)

(Note: Bang Energy, which previously occupied a top spot at 300 mg, has shifted availability following its acquisition by Monster, leaving Reign as the dominant mass-market 300 mg heavy hitter).

What Are the Healthiest Energy Drinks?

Let's establish an absolute ground rule: no energy drink on this list is truly healthy or a substitute for a balanced lifestyle. They are highly processed, engineered beverages. However, if you find yourself needing to choose one to pull an emergency late shift or fuel a workout, certain formulations minimize the physiological damage far better than others.

When isolating the "healthiest" (or more accurately, the least harmful) options, we prioritize three factors: zero sugarcontrolled caffeine dosage, and the absence of toxic chemical dyes or opaque proprietary formulas.

Based on these parameters, here are the top choices:

1. Celsius

Celsius takes the top spot as the least harmful option for a few vital reasons:

  • The Sugar Profile: It contains zero grams of sugar, sparing your body from a devastating insulin surge and metabolic crash.
  • Cleaner Labeling: It completely avoids artificial preservatives, high-fructose corn syrup, and synthetic chemical colorings.
  • Natural Influences: The caffeine blend is pulled from natural sources, including green tea extract and guarana seeds, which enter your system slightly more smoothly than pure synthetic caffeine anhydrous. It also includes ginger root extract, which can mitigate some of the stomach irritation commonly caused by carbonated stimulants.

2. Alani Nu

Alani Nu scores highly because it successfully balances a cleaner chemical profile with a controlled, modern volume size:

  • Volume Control: By capping their cans at 12 ounces instead of the massive 16-ounce standard, you consume less fluid volume loaded with chemical sweetening agents.
  • Clean Formulation: It features zero sugar, very low sodium, and leaves out the hyper-aggressive herbal stimulant blends (like ginkgo biloba) that older brands use to artificially inflate their effects.
  • Transparency: It is simple, clear, and provides a clean dose of daily B-vitamins without turning the drink into an experimental chemistry lab.

3. Ghost Energy

While Ghost targets a very young, vibrant demographic with candy-themed partnerships, its internal engineering is surprisingly robust from a health-conscious standpoint:

  • 100% Transparent Labeling: Ghost is one of the few mainstream brands that rejects the concept of a "proprietary energy blend." The back of the can lists the exact milligram breakdown of every single active ingredient, from the taurine to the neuro-nutrients.
  • No Artificial Dyes: Despite flavors modeled after bright candies like Sour Patch Kids, the liquid itself pours completely clear because Ghost refuses to use synthetic food coloring agents that have been linked to behavioral hyper-activity and gut irritation.
  • Metabolic Safety: It has zero sugar and zero carbs, relying on highly purified sweeteners that don't disrupt blood glucose levels.

Quick Takeaways for Navigating the Energy Drink Market

  • Audit Your Caffeine Volumetrics: Keep a strict mental tally of your intake. The FDA sets the safe daily limit for healthy adults at 400 mg. If you drink a single high-stimulant option like Reign (300 mg), you have almost entirely exhausted your allowance for the day in a matter of minutes.
  • Banish the Sugar Bombs: Check the back label specifically for "Added Sugars." Avoid legacy cans of Monster, Rockstar, or NOS that pack 50 to 60 grams of sugar per serving. The metabolic tax is simply too high.
  • Beware the 12 PM Cutoff: Because high doses of caffeine have an average half-life of 5 to 7 hours, an energy drink consumed at 3:00 PM is still actively circulating in your brain at midnight. Cut off all energy drinks by noon to shield your sleep architecture from destruction.
  • Never Mix with Alcohol: Mixing co-acting depressants (alcohol) and stimulants (energy drinks) dulls your brain's natural ability to track how intoxicated you are. This leads to dangerous levels of alcohol poisoning and puts immense, erratic stress on your cardiovascular system.
  • Hydrate in Parallel: For every can of energy drink you consume, force yourself to drink an equal volume of pure water. This helps protect your kidneys, flushes out extra synthetic vitamins, and wards off stimulant-induced dehydration.
  • Ultimately, authentic energy cannot be manufactured inside an aluminum can. True, sustainable vitality is a byproduct of consistent hydration, a nutrient-dense whole-food diet, regular physical movement, and high-quality sleep. Treat energy drinks as a rare, intentional tool for exceptional circumstances—not an everyday foundation for life.

Frequently Asked Questions (FAQ)

Are sugar-free energy drinks healthy?

No, sugar-free energy drinks are not entirely healthy. While they eliminate the empty calories and blood sugar spikes associated with regular energy drinks, they still contain high amounts of caffeine and artificial additives. These ingredients can still cause heart strain, anxiety, and sleep disruption if consumed regularly.

How much caffeine is in an energy drink compared to coffee?

A standard 8-ounce cup of brewed coffee contains roughly 90–100 mg of caffeine. In comparison, a classic 8.4-ounce Red Bull has 80 mg, while popular 16-ounce fitness energy drinks like Ghost, Celsius, or Reign contain between 200 mg and 300 mg of caffeine per can.

What are the side effects of drinking energy drinks daily?

Daily consumption of energy drinks can lead to chronic side effects, including increased blood pressure, heart palpitations, chronic insomnia, heightened anxiety, headaches, and digestive issues. Over time, sugar-loaded options can also significantly increase the risk of type 2 diabetes and tooth decay.

What is the absolute safest energy drink?

There is no "perfectly safe" commercial energy drink, but options like Celsius, Alani Nu, and Ghost are considered the least harmful. They are sugar-free, avoid artificial food dyes, and provide transparent ingredient labels, making it easier to manage your stimulant intake. For a truly natural alternative, consider unsweetened green tea or black coffee.
